Output 142a3d159bbb5cb9c91381afc99a8496e152f3c6ca92b82649698148a112c7b7:0

value
587528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a524a07b585825136cc3f41710a65ea6ae08734 OP_EQUALVERIFY OP_CHECKSIG
address
1AhBCtRAtpEhYE38UKZV2iqTPUupMJCJ6p
transaction
142a3d159bbb5cb9c91381afc99a8496e152f3c6ca92b82649698148a112c7b7
spent
true